Overview of City National Arena Jobs

City National Arena in Summerlin, Nevada, serves as a multipurpose facility focused on training, events, and year-round operations. Job opportunities typically align with arena operations, including event services, facility and ice maintenance, guest experience, retail and concessions, and security. Because the venue supports public skating, lessons, camps, clinics, and professional team activities, roles often require flexible evening and weekend schedules. This guide covers common positions, typical qualifications, how to apply, and what to expect in the hiring process at City National Arena.

Common Job Categories at City National Arena

Opportunities at City National Arena generally group into several functional areas. Event Services staff supports ticketing, concessions, and crowd flow during public sessions, lessons, and events. Facility and Ice Maintenance roles focus on ice resurfacing, refrigeration, and general upkeep of the arena environment. Guest Experience positions prioritize customer service at the box office, front desk, and membership services. Retail and Concessions roles handle merchandise and food service operations. Security positions help maintain safety and enforce venue policies during public and private events.

Event Services

Event Services roles are central to arena operations, especially during high-activity periods such as public skate sessions, youth hockey games, figure skating practices, and special events. Responsibilities include processing transactions, assisting guests, coordinating floor staff, and ensuring smooth event execution. Candidates often benefit from previous customer service or retail experience and the ability to work evenings, nights, and weekends.

Facility and Ice Maintenance

These technical roles support the refrigeration systems, ice quality, and overall facility upkeep. Duties may include monitoring ice conditions, performing routine maintenance on equipment, and responding to facility needs in a timely manner. Positions in this category often require mechanical aptitude, attention to safety standards, and sometimes specific technical training or certifications related to refrigeration and ice arena systems.

Guest Experience and Administrative Support

Front-desk and membership roles focus on guest inquiries, scheduling, and account management. These positions require strong communication skills, professionalism, and comfort with ticketing or membership software. Administrative support roles may also assist with coordinating schedules, processing payments, and maintaining accurate records for arena activities.

Retail and Concessions

Concessions and retail staff play a key role in arena hospitality, handling point-of-sale systems, inventory, and guest service during events. Shifts typically align with event schedules, which can include evenings, weekends, and holiday periods. Previous point-of-sale or food service experience is often preferred but not always required.

Security and Safety

Security roles at City National Arena are responsible for maintaining a safe environment for guests, staff, and athletes. Duties include monitoring entrances, managing crowd control, and following emergency procedures. Positions often require compliance with venue policies, strong observational skills, and the ability to work varied shifts in a dynamic environment.

Scheduling, Availability, and Peak Periods

Because City National Arena supports frequent public and team events, scheduling can include evenings, nights, weekends, and holidays. Availability for flexible hours is often important, particularly for guest-facing roles. Peak staffing periods typically align with hockey seasons, figure skating competitions, concerts, and holiday public skate sessions. Employees in these areas should expect increased hours during these times and possible short-notice shift changes.

Training, Onboarding, and Development

Many roles include initial training on safety procedures, customer service standards, and equipment-specific guidance. Training duration varies by role, with technical positions often involving longer onboarding to ensure competency with refrigeration and facility systems. Ongoing development may include cross-training to support multiple arena functions and opportunities to advance into lead or specialized positions with demonstrated performance and reliability.
